Hi Matthew,
thank you for the hint! In the lvconvert-manpage they write:
"This option is only available to RAID segment types (e.g. raid1,
raid5, etc)"
So I assume this will not work with thinpool-devices, but using raid
with this trick is another good idea.
Tfh!
Oliver
Am 18.11.2014 um 17:55 schrieb matthew patton:
> I think 'lvconvert --replace /dev/<ssd> VG/LV /dev/<slow disk>'
> will do what you want.
